Earth Day didn"t knock gently. It kicked the door wide open. In 1970, oil‑soaked beaches, burning rivers and toxic air mobilised millions into street protests. When looking away was no longer an option, conservation was forced onto political agendas, sparking landmark environmental laws and flipping planet‑care from fringe concern to global priority. Every 22 April, over 190 countries pause, reflect and reassess.
